You are viewing a plain text version of this content. The canonical link for it is here.
Posted to users-fr@cocoon.apache.org by Laurent Perez <ha...@gmail.com> on 2005/12/07 17:26:17 UTC
Problème de caching (performances ?)
Hello
Je n'arrive pas à interpréter les messages d'erreur suivants, qui
apparaissent dans le fichier de logs de Tomcat lorsque mon appli
Cocoon reçoit beaucoup de requêtes simultanées / concurrentes :
En premier, j'obtiens ces erreurs :
22:42:14,826 ERROR [LRUMemoryCache] verifycache[main]: map does not
contain value :
org.apache.jcs.engine.memory.lru.MemoryElementDescriptor@1e3c2de
22:42:14,859 ERROR [LRUMemoryCache] verifycache[main]: key not found
in list : PK_G-file-file:/appli/tomcat/webapps/ROOT/sites/foo/resources/xml/foo.xml
22:42:14,862 ERROR [LRUMemoryCache] verifycache: map contains key
C'est toujours ce triplé, répété de nombreuses fois : pour info,
foo.xml est déclaré dans :
<map:pipeline internal-only="true" type="caching">
<map:match pattern="data/includes/foo.xml">
<map:generate src="resources/xml/foo.xml"/>
<map:serialize type="xml"/>
</map:match>
Au bout d'un moment, plus tard dans la journée, je n'ai plus que ces
logs (c.a.d plus un triplé) :
22:50:18,144 ERROR [LRUMemoryCache] verifycache[main]: map does not
contain value :
org.apache.jcs.engine.memory.lru.MemoryElementDescriptor@1e3c2de
Et bizarrement, l'appli met de plus en plus de temps à répondre, pour
au final de plus jamais répondre, et je dois redémarrer la webapp.
Est-ce un problème lié à JCS, ou est-ce que ces messages sont "normaux" ?
Pour info, le StatusGenerator de Cocoon (qui lui aussi met de plus en
plus de temps à répondre) me donne un
"org.apache.cocoon.components.store.impl.JCSDefaultStore" avec tous
mes fichiers statiques utilisés par Cocoon (plusieurs centaines) dans
le cache avec un "0 are empty".
Laurent
--
<a href="http://in-pocket.blogspot.com">http://in-pocket.blogspot.com
- Mobile world, technology and more</a>
---------------------------------------------------------------------
Liste francophone Apache Cocoon -- http://cocoon.apache.org/fr/
Pour vous desinscrire : mailto:users-fr-unsubscribe@cocoon.apache.org
Autres commandes : mailto:users-fr-help@cocoon.apache.org
Re: Problème de caching (performances ?)
Posted by Laurent Perez <ha...@gmail.com>.
Hello
Cocoon 2.1.5, et en effet j'ai choisi de remplacer JCS par Whirlycache
(1) aujourd'hui, je verrai si je retrouve des messages d'erreur
similaires ce week-end. Par contre, le StatusGenerator ne m'affiche
plus les stats des stores depuis que j'ai enlevé JCS.
(1) https://whirlycache.dev.java.net
laurent
---------------------------------------------------------------------
Liste francophone Apache Cocoon -- http://cocoon.apache.org/fr/
Pour vous desinscrire : mailto:users-fr-unsubscribe@cocoon.apache.org
Autres commandes : mailto:users-fr-help@cocoon.apache.org
Re: Problème de caching (performances ?)
Posted by Jean-Baptiste Quenot <jb...@anyware-tech.com>.
Bonjour,
Tu n'as pas mentionné la version de Cocoon utilisée, mais je crois
savoir qu'elle n'est pas toute jeune, et notamment utilise le
système de cache JCS, qui je crois a été remplacé par EHCache.
Serait-il possible de retester avec une version plus récente?
--
Jean-Baptiste Quenot
Systèmes d'Information
ANYWARE TECHNOLOGIES
Tel : +33 (0)5 61 00 52 90
Fax : +33 (0)5 61 00 51 46
http://www.anyware-tech.com/
---------------------------------------------------------------------
Liste francophone Apache Cocoon -- http://cocoon.apache.org/fr/
Pour vous desinscrire : mailto:users-fr-unsubscribe@cocoon.apache.org
Autres commandes : mailto:users-fr-help@cocoon.apache.org